Government should Be Responsible For Currency Issuance

The president of Microsoft, Brad Smith has made it known to the public that the government should be in charge of currency Issuance.

Smith stressed that various currencies need to be managed by an entity to ensure that public interest is protected.

As at the time of writing this news, the following information was gathered;

The President of microsoft has said that it is best for the world to use currencies that are issued, backed by and regulated by the government.

He also pointed out that he is not a fan of encouraging the private sector to issue digital currencies.

Smith expressed dissatisfaction on the issuance of digital currencies by the private sector during an online conference on Wednesday, which was hosted by the bank for international settlements (BIS).

On that account, the question "can tech forms be trusted to issue money?" And whether it is something Microsoft can do, Smith replied by saying that "it is not a place where we have gone and I don't think it is a place we will go. He pointed out that when the social media giant Facebook tried embarking on Cryptocurrency Libra, which was called Diem, it was revolted against.

Smith confirmed by answering that "I think the first question that the world needs to ask is "is the world served best when private companies issue their own currency.

He also stated, that "the world is beside served when currencies are issued, backed by and regulated by governments.

The Coronavirus pandemic accelerated the shift in digital payments and massive stimulus packages, and have fueled interest in cryptocurrencies such as bitcoin.

In addition the Facebook backed Cryptocurrency and it's payment network are expected to commence soon.

Another important update from the news is that the trend towards non-government backed digital currencies has raised concerns among policymakers worldwide, money laundering and loss of control over the monetary system.
